Figure 1

Invariant mass distributions after combinatorial background subtraction for \kstar and \phim candidates in the multiplicity class 0--10$\%$ and transverse momentum range 2.2 $\leq$ $p_{\mathrm{T}}$ $<$ 3.0 GeV/$c$ in the rapidity interval \mbox{-0.3 $< y <$ 0} (panels (a) and (b)) and 0 $< y <$ 0.3 (panels (c) and (d)). The \kstar peak is described by a Breit-Wigner function whereas the \phim peak is fitted with a Voigtian function. The residual background is described by a polynomial function of order 2.
